
Search by job, company or skills
This job is no longer accepting applications
Java _J2EE Developer
Exp : 5+ years
Location : Qatar
Key Responsibilities
Develop and maintain web applications using Java, Spring Boot, and other backend technologies.
Design and implement responsive user interfaces using HTML, CSS, JavaScript, and modern frameworks like React, Angular, or Next.js.
Collaborate with UI/UX designers, product managers, and other developers to understand requirements and deliver high-quality solutions.
Create and consume RESTful APIs for communication between front-end and back-end systems.
Participate in code reviews, testing, debugging, and deployment activities.
Stay up-to-date with emerging technologies and best practices in full-stack development.
Required Skills and Qualifications
Strong proficiency in Java and frameworks such as Spring / Spring Boot.
Experience with front-end technologies: HTML5, CSS3, JavaScript, and frameworks like React, Angular, or Next.js.
Experience with RESTful APIs and microservices architecture.
Familiarity with databases: SQL (MySQL, PostgreSQL) and NoSQL (MongoDB, etc.).
Understanding of Software Development Life Cycle (SDLC) and Agile/Scrum methodologies.
Experience with unit testing and test-driven development (TDD) is a plus.
Job ID: 144530501